Description
This classic waffle recipe gives you light, fluffy waffles with a golden crisp edge. It’s perfect for breakfast or brunch and can be topped with anything from maple syrup to fresh berries.
Ingredients
2 cups all-purpose flour
2 tablespoons sugar
1 tablespo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 large eggs
1 3/4 cups milk
1/2 cup melted butter
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Instructions
1. Preheat your waffle iron.
2. In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
3. In another bowl, beat the eggs, then add milk, melted butter, and vanilla.
4. Pour the wet ingredients into the dry and mix until just combined.
5. Lightly grease the waffle iron and pour in the batter.
6. Cook according to waffle iron instructions until golden brown.
7. Serve warm with your favorite toppings.
Notes
For crispier waffles, cook slightly longer.
You can substitute buttermilk for regular milk for extra flavor.
